2-Stage Pump Design
The 2-stage pump is a critical feature, compressing air in two steps rather than one. This process results in higher pressures (up to 175 PSI, often adjustable) and more efficient operation. Additionally, 2-stage compression produces cooler and drier air, which is less damaging to air tools and helps prevent moisture buildup in air lines, extending the life of your pneumatic equipment.
Pressure Lubricated Pump
Unlike splash-lubricated pumps, the EMAX E350 features a fully pressure-lubricated pump system. This advanced system forces oil through the pump’s critical components, providing consistent lubrication regardless of the pump’s orientation or operating conditions. This significantly reduces friction, dissipates heat more effectively, and drastically extends the pump’s lifespan, akin to an automotive engine’s lubrication system.

Q2: How does the 2-stage pump differ from a single-stage pump, and why is it better for industrial use?
A 2-stage pump compresses air in two steps: first to an intermediate pressure, then to the final higher pressure. This process is more efficient, produces less heat, and results in cooler, drier air. For industrial use, this means higher sustained pressure, better tool performance, and less moisture in air lines, which extends the life of pneumatic tools and reduces maintenance. Single-stage pumps are generally for lighter-duty, intermittent use.
Q3: What does ‘pressure lubricated’ mean, and what are its benefits?
Pressure lubrication means that oil is actively pumped through the compressor’s critical moving parts, similar to an automotive engine. This ensures constant and adequate lubrication regardless of operating conditions or temperature. The benefits include significantly extended pump lifespan, reduced friction and heat buildup, and superior protection against wear compared to splash-lubricated systems.

Q5: What kind of maintenance does the EMAX E350 Air Compressor require?
Regular maintenance is key to the longevity of the EMAX E350. This includes routine oil changes (typically every 3-6 months or after a certain number of operating hours, depending on use), checking and replacing air filters, draining condensation from the tank daily to prevent rust, and inspecting belts and connections. Following the manufacturer’s manual for specific maintenance schedules is highly recommended.
